GENERAL BACKGROUND
The Triumph TR3 was introduced in 1955 and was so successful that the original panel tooling wore out from so much production and had to be replaced for the model to complete its run in 1962. It was the very first production British car to employ (front) disc brakes in 1956. The cars fundamentals are so good that it is still seen competing in the Sports Car of America (SCCA) E-production class. Its classic British good looks are timeless, and it is beloved in enthusiast circles worldwide.

NOTE: Because the state of Georgia did not begin issuing auto titles until 1962, all previous model year vehicles are NOT required to be titled...including (of course) this 1960 Triumph. ALL states must respect the title/registration rules of other states, therefore, the Bill of Sale and signed-off Registration document provided should allow the buyer to register and insure the 1960 Triumph in ANY state. Whether or not your state will issue a title depends totally on the title/registration rules of your state. If you have questions, please contact your local Motor Vehicle office.
